## Configuration

The Furrowlink gateway reads its settings from `/etc/furrowlink/gateway.env` at boot. All telemetry from connected harvesters is signed before upload to the Agrivane relay, so the signing credential must be present before the service starts. File permissions should be 0600, owned by the `furrowlink` user. Reviewers should confirm the credential is never logged. The relay signing secret is set on the following line.

vault entry, kafog-yahop: COURIER_KEY8=0faa53ae

Welcome to the Quillgate plugin program. Before your extension can enqueue candidates into the ProctorLine exam-proctoring queue, you must register a sandbox tenant and complete the handshake walkthrough. Please read the queue-ordering guarantees carefully: items may be redelivered, so your handlers must be idempotent. Once your sandbox is provisioned, our onboarding bot issues a recovery passphrase for restoring queue credentials. You will find that passphrase directly below this paragraph.

vault phrase of bagaf-kajeg = jorath-feniel-briir-siliel-ralix

## CrashFunnel Environments

Welcome aboard! CrashFunnel (our mobile crash-report pipeline) runs in three environments: sandbox, staging, and prod. Sandbox is a free-for-all, staging mirrors prod data minus user symbols, and prod is hands-off without a ticket. Each environment has its own ingest endpoint and retention window. To get oriented, here's the staging configuration as currently deployed.

deployment values, tafog-kagap:
wenath:
  pin: 4244
  metrics_host: metrics.wenath.lumicsys.internal
  tenant: istix
  seal: seal_10585894

Visitor Policy — Guest Wi-Fi Desk

A quick note for everyone on reception at Larkspool House: all visitors wanting internet access should be pointed to the guest Wi-Fi desk just past the turnstiles, not handed credentials at the counter. The desk volunteer will sort them out with a day pass and the usual acceptable-use chat. If nobody's staffing the desk (it happens around lunch), reception can open the desk drawer and issue passes directly. To unlock the drawer panel, enter the staff code shown below.

turnstile pass: bdg-QZV-3